Trans flags raised in Alberta a sign of progress: advocates


To have that safety and know that we can walk down the street and not fear for our lives, is really, really important." Angela Reid of the Trans Equality Society of Alberta says many trans people are pushed into lives of poverty and unsafe working conditions. "I think there's a huge, huge threat now or a huge feeling of a threat anyway, that we're going to go, everyone's going to go backward," Deedee said. Annual event in EdmontonIn Edmonton, raising the trans flag is already an annual event. Jan Buterman — former president of TESA — said he felt encouraged to hear government officials such as Miranda acknowledge the struggles of transgender people in Alberta.
